There are no ground spawned forges or other tradeskill containers, but you can summon forges and use them just like a sewing kit or other portable "toolkit" item.
There's also a portable item called a Smithing Kit (no idea how you get this in EQLive, I've never seen or heard of it; maybe it's a GM/guide item). I've made this item purchasable from smithing supply merchants in my DB addon.

To Hardy - if you create any of these quests, would I be able to add them to my DB when you release them?
I'm not working on quests at the minute (I'm mainly doing tradeskills and finishing the basic loot tables) so you don't need to worry about someone else doing the same thing.
I was planning on adding the epic quests - however we really need multi item turn-ins for these to work properly.
